- In a dark match, Funaki beat KC James after a sunset flip.

 

- The Boogeyman vs The Miz & Kristal went to a no-contest to open Smackdown. No official announcement was made on the result.

 

- Backstage, King Booker and Finlay got talking as it was announced they’ll be taking on Batista and Bobby Lashley later on in the show

 

- Footage of Rey Mysterio undergoing knee surgery last week was shown.

This is from another report

 

(3) William Regal defeated Paul London (with Ashley at ringside) in easily the best match of the night. This is not my British bias showing through, this really was a very good match that should play well on tv. These two worked extremely well together and Regal put on a real clinic. He was clearly motivated and on his game tonight. Surprisingly the crowd was split early (probably due to the high number of young kids who like London) but as the match wore on, they were far more in favour of Regal. Key moment in the match saw Regal throw London over the top rope, and he accidentally landed on Ashley, who sold the bump big time. Regal didn’t really play heel during this match, and received a big crowd pop for his win. After the match, Brian Kendrick ran out and consoled both London and Ashley.
